Top Roofing: Choosing the Best for Your Home

When it comes to home improvements, one of the most significant aspects to consider is the roof. A well-maintained roof not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of your home but also protects your property from the elements. With a variety of roofing materials and styles available, selecting the top roofing option can be daunting. This article aims to guide you through the top roofing choices, their benefits, and what you should consider when making a decision.

Among the most popular roofing materials are asphalt shingles, metal roofing, and tile roofing. Asphalt shingles are favored for their cost-effectiveness and ease of installation. They come in various colors and styles, allowing homeowners to customize their roofs to match their home’s exterior. Metal roofing, although initially more expensive, boasts longevity and durability, often lasting for decades. Its reflective surface also adds energy efficiency by reducing cooling costs. Tile roofing provides a classic look that can elevate the overall design of your home, while also offering excellent durability and resistance to harsh weather conditions.

When selecting your roofing material, consider your local climate and weather conditions. Different materials perform better in specific environments. For instance, areas prone to heavy rain might benefit from metal roofing due to its ability to shed water quickly, while those in hotter climates may want to look into tile or reflective shingles to keep their home cooler. Additionally, it’s crucial to assess the slope and design of your roof, as some materials work better with particular roof structures.

Besides material, another important factor is the installation process. Hiring a reputable roofing contractor is essential to ensure that your roof is installed correctly and adheres to local building codes. Poor installation can lead to leaks and other issues that could be costly to repair in the long run. It’s worth investing time in researching and selecting a skilled contractor who has experience with the type of roofing you choose.
